
Electricity supply has been restored in most of Spain and Portugal after a massive blackout on April 28, 2025, left millions without power. By Tuesday morning, over 99% of Spain’s power networks were operational, and Portugal’s grid had stabilized. The outage disrupted transportation, telecommunications, and daily life across the Iberian Peninsula. Authorities are investigating the cause, with theories ranging from rare atmospheric phenomena to cyberattacks, though no definitive explanation has been confirmed. Both Spanish and Portuguese governments have scheduled crisis meetings to analyze the incident.
